    Abstract: A bale ejecting mechanism includes a shuttle shiftable toward and away from the open end in repetitive ejection and retraction strokes. The shuttle has a series of projections yieldably biased to an extended position projecting into the bale case for engaging and moving a bale during an ejection stroke of the shuttle. The projections are shiftable into a retracted position disposed outside of the bale case to avoid engaging and moving a bale during an ejection stroke. The mechanism includes a selector member movable with the shuttle during ejection and retraction strokes of the shuttle but shiftable relative to the shuttle to any one of a number of selectable retaining positions in which the selector member retains selected ones of the projections in the retracted position. An adjustable shifter member is disposable in a plurality of selectable operating positions corresponding to the selectable retaining positions of the selector member.
